Statement prepared by Mr. T. Sutherland, inspector of the poor, Saline, of the history of Saline public hall

Sutherland, T.
Books, Manuscripts
Photocopy of a typed version of a well-researched document from Mr. Sutherland. He relates, in detail, how the 1840 building was originally a subscription school, with connections to the Free church in the village. Following the building of a new public school in 1875, the subscription school suffered a fall in attendance and around 1886, it became, instead, a hall for public use.
